Abstract

Various aspects of statistical validation of genetic models are reviewed. Possible ways of decomposing additive genetic variance over time and ways of comparing predictions at different times are suggested. Ways of circumventing difficulties because of selection are suggested. The uses of cross-validatory techniques are illustrated. Techniques introduced to validate multiple country evaluation are discussed. The analogy of multiple country evaluation with sequential comparison of predictors is shown.
